Help For Panic Attacks – The Key is Identifying the Cause No Comments

A panic attack can be described as an immediate rush of overwhelming anxiety and fear. You may feel your heart pound, become short of breath, feel dizzy, or think you are going crazy. Which Type of Anxiety Disorder Do You Have? No Comments

When you hear people talking about anxiety they quite often refer to it as an anxiety ‘disorder’. The medical profession tend to use the term ‘disorder’, usually in the context of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D), Panic Disorder and Social Anxiety Disorder (SAD).
